Sat 1284417406694151

decimal
303766.2406694151
degree
0°93766′1366″2406694151‴
percentile
61.16273371938147%
name
etenalogtxa
cycle
0
epoch
1
period
150
block
303766
offset
2406694151
timestamp
rarity
common